Reema Dbouk, MD, is an Assistant Professor of Medicine at Emory University School of Medicine, where she practices obesity medicine and primary care. Dr. Dbouk is passionate about addressing weight bias and stigma, particularly in healthcare settings, and promoting a weight-inclusive, patient-centered approach that addresses the social, cultural, and psychological factors influencing health.
